How to decide your target audience

First of all you need to have a clearer view who are your target audience and how you can address that group. Some of the following points to get a clear idea.

  • Who is your target audience?
  • Is your content relevant to your target group age, sex and demography?
  • What is the focal point of your content? Why they care to read you? What is the solution you offer to them?
  • What is the major influencing driver?
  • What are the related fields that can pull your target group?
  • Where they spend most of the time in online?
  • Where you want to get coverage?

Use a domain research website tools like Open Site Explorer, Ahrefs and others to evaluate which pages attract most inbound links. This piece of information will give an idea what type of commercial content lures most of the people. You can also run Buzz sumo to analysis the individual domains social shares per post. It will also give you analysis on social penetration by content type.
